Two state-of-the-art technologies packaged into one small device - the Dual Function Circuit Breaker combines GFCI and AFCI, protecting against both arc faults and ground faults. This, along with the new Self Test & Lockout feature, makes it first in class for electrical safety for homeowners. The dual function circuit breaker combines these two devices into one solution that provides both cost savings and less hassle in installation and maintenance. Underwriters Laboratories® (UL) suggests that AFCI/GFCI devices be tested every 30 days after installation to ensure they are properly working. The new Self Test & Lockout feature enables the dual function circuit breaker to automatically and continuously test itself to ensure that it is working properly. If it is detected that the device has been compromised, the device trips itself and locks out the homeowner from resetting the device, reducing the possibility of the homeowner incorrectly assuming that the device was tripped to prevent a ground/arc fault. This effortless system guarantees that only the best protection is given to your home at all times.
